Output 7b253bf40123dcf206cb7ba76589c4b5e724cfee9e1fc744acfc98e35071b07f:0

value
149610
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c871e8a04a1adb234766a5e5e01e7bb676b59d99 OP_EQUAL
address
3KxsXRbCDo2RRF6nSbJe5yfM88fbKSES55
transaction
7b253bf40123dcf206cb7ba76589c4b5e724cfee9e1fc744acfc98e35071b07f
confirmations
160344
spent
true